Output 316257a14392cf9cbe7c1e4148e26b31e40d20d92775f2a27c0601353a2f404d:4

value
24826418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 638d51cd0e80930e3930294cf344576aa3f08af7 OP_EQUAL
address
MGyYRUVd82R9N783KAtWBx6bWa6TV1vFFa
transaction
316257a14392cf9cbe7c1e4148e26b31e40d20d92775f2a27c0601353a2f404d
spent
true